FAQ: How do I get my trade-in payment? After your device is processed, you'll receive a credit for its assessed value. If you've paid for your new device in full, the trade-in credit will be refunded to your account within the next two billing cycles. Otherwise, a monthly credit will be applied to your Device Payment Plan in equal increments for the remainder of the plan, starting within two billing cycles.

I do in-store, though. Sales tax is applied differently (since your trade-in is evaluated and applied right away) as opposed to doing it online and waiting for the promo credit to hit.
If you're paying in full, there is nothing involving "3 years" at all. It's paid.
If you do it online, you pay the FULL sales tax of the device and the credit is applied later, no sales tax refunded.
I will literally save something like $95 doing it in-store rather than online.

I logged in to My Spectrum account yesterday and had no credit yet. This morning, I logged in again and the full amount for the trade-in + promotional has applied to my mobile account. I called Spectrum and in about 5 minutes the agent processed my request for refund to my cc. Smooth process.
Things to note about changes from previous years:
1) They cannot process a credit refund directly anymore, must create a ticket for another to process it
2) You cannot change the method of refund. Prior years you could change the credit card attached on account and they would just refund to that card... Now it will just credit back on the card you bought the new phone on
